Charger un document OneNote 2007 - Java

Introduction

Dans ce didacticiel, nous aborderons l’utilisation d’Aspose.Note pour Java pour charger des documents OneNote 2007 de manière transparente. Aspose.Note est une puissante bibliothèque Java qui permet aux développeurs de travailler avec des fichiers Microsoft OneNote par programme, permettant ainsi une large gamme d’applications allant de la manipulation de documents à l’automatisation. À la fin de ce guide, vous disposerez des connaissances nécessaires pour charger sans effort des documents OneNote 2007 dans vos applications Java.

Conditions préalables

Avant de plonger dans le didacticiel, assurez-vous que les conditions préalables suivantes sont remplies :

Configuration de l’environnement de développement Java

Assurez-vous que le kit de développement Java (JDK) est installé sur votre système. Vous pouvez télécharger et installer la dernière version de JDK à partir du site Web d’Oracle.

Aspose.Note pour la bibliothèque Java

Téléchargez et incluez la bibliothèque Aspose.Note pour Java dans votre projet Java. Vous pouvez obtenir la bibliothèque auprès dulien de téléchargement.

Importer des packages

Pour commencer à charger des documents OneNote 2007 à l’aide d’Aspose.Note pour Java, vous devez importer les packages nécessaires :

import com.aspose.note.Document;
import com.aspose.note.FileFormat;
import com.aspose.note.UnsupportedFileFormatException;

Maintenant, décomposons le processus de chargement d’un document OneNote 2007 en plusieurs étapes :

Étape 1 : Définir le répertoire des documents

Tout d’abord, définissez le répertoire dans lequel se trouve votre document OneNote 2007. Ce chemin de répertoire sera utilisé pour localiser et charger le document.

String dataDir = "Your Document Directory";

Étape 2 : charger le document OneNote 2007

Maintenant, chargeons le document OneNote 2007 dans Aspose.Note pour Java. Cette étape consiste à utiliser leDocument classe pour charger le document à partir du répertoire spécifié.

// ExDébut : LoadOneNote2007
// Chargez le document dans Aspose.Note.
try {
    new Document(dataDir + "OneNote2007.one");
}
catch (UnsupportedFileFormatException e)
{
    if (e.getFileFormat() == FileFormat.OneNote2007)
    {
        System.out.println("It looks like the provided file is in OneNote 2007 format that is not supported.");
    }
    else
        throw e;
}
// ExFin : LoadOneNote2007

Au cours de cette étape, le document OneNote 2007 fourni est chargé dans Aspose.Note. LeDocument Le constructeur prend le chemin du fichier comme paramètre, permettant un chargement transparent du document.

Étape 3 : Gérer les formats de fichiers non pris en charge

Il est essentiel de gérer correctement tous les formats de fichiers non pris en charge. Si le fichier fourni est dans un format non pris en charge, récupérez leUnsupportedFileFormatException et gérez-le en conséquence.

catch (UnsupportedFileFormatException e)
{
    if (e.getFileFormat() == FileFormat.OneNote2007)
    {
        System.out.println("It looks like the provided file is in OneNote 2007 format that is not supported.");
    }
    else
        throw e;
}

Conclusion

Dans ce didacticiel, nous avons expliqué comment charger des documents OneNote 2007 à l’aide d’Aspose.Note pour Java. En suivant le guide étape par étape et en incorporant les extraits de code fournis dans votre application Java, vous pouvez intégrer de manière transparente la fonctionnalité de chargement de documents OneNote. Aspose.Note simplifie le processus, permettant aux développeurs de se concentrer sur la création d’applications robustes sans se soucier des subtilités de la gestion des documents.

FAQ

Q1 : Aspose.Note est-il compatible avec d’autres versions de documents OneNote ?

A1 : Aspose.Note prend en charge différentes versions de documents OneNote, notamment 2007, 2010 et 2013.

Q2 : Puis-je manipuler des documents OneNote par programme à l’aide d’Aspose.Note ?

A2 : Oui, Aspose.Note fournit des fonctionnalités étendues pour manipuler par programme les documents OneNote, notamment la modification, la conversion et l’extraction de contenu.

Q3 : Où puis-je trouver une assistance et des ressources supplémentaires pour Aspose.Note ?

A3 : Vous pouvez explorer leForum Aspose.Note pour obtenir de l’aide, des tutoriels et des discussions.

Q4 : Existe-t-il un essai gratuit disponible pour Aspose.Note ?

A4 : Oui, vous pouvez bénéficier de l’essai gratuit d’Aspose.Note dusite web.

Q5 : Comment puis-je obtenir une licence temporaire pour Aspose.Note ?

A5 : Vous pouvez obtenir une licence temporaire pour Aspose.Note auprès dupage de licence temporaire.